    Carrier 48SS

    Hi,i have a carrier 48SS AC & gas heat problem.last year i replaced the induced draft motor and unit worked fine all winter.now when starting it will heat fine untill it reaches the themostat setting then sometimes it comes on but the gas never ignites. sometimes it will though.i have pulled the cover and have the manual that came with it.now i show a fault code of 6 flashes which means inducer fault switch.anyone know where that switch is located
    model of unit is 48SS-024060311

    THANKS in advance robert

    before this code i had another......limit switch fault i removed that switch and unplugged the connectors the replaced several times to make good contact now i have this other code....

    if you look on your print you may find an air flow switch. this is a "sail" switch with a metal paddle on it. It detects air flow before the gas control kicks in. the inducer fan runs a few minutes to purge the heat exchanger of unburnt gases. once air flow is detected it should kick in the pilot light or spark system for the pilot.

              Hall effect sensor

              On the end of the motor facing outward, there is a cover over where you would think a bearing might be. Under this cover is a magnetic switch. As the motor turns it opens and closes a switch sending a square wave signal to the board. This sensor may be your problem. Should be a part number like 50HJ401484 or something similar.
